Pain Management Therapy

In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M), pain treatment follows a balanced approach, where we treat the body as a whole. This includes the principle of "treating the upper body by stimulating the lower body, and treating the left side by stimulating the right side." For example, pain in the upper limbs can be treated by acupuncture on the lower limbs, and pain in the left hand can be treated by stimulating acupoints on the right hand, and vice versa. This reflects TCM's holistic view, emphasizing balance in the body.

Pain can also be categorized as either deficient or excessive. In simple terms, deficient pain arises from insufficient Qi and blood, causing the tissues to be "un-nourished and painful," while excessive pain is due to Qi and blood stagnation, where the flow is blocked, leading to pain from "obstruction."

In treating pain, TCM not only focuses on local pain relief but also takes into account the nature (deficient or excessive) and location of the pain. The treatment is tailored to restore balance throughout the body—up and down, left and right—addressing conditions of "obstruction" or "insufficient nourishment." The goal is not just to relieve the pain, but also to treat the underlying causes, ensuring a long-term solution.
